General information on summer outingsA user’s guide for persons unfamiliar with French
The summer programme is mailed at the start of the season to all members of the Club. A more detailed description of each outing is made available at sign-up time. In particular, information is then provided regarding the place and time of departure, and the exact cost of each excursion. Each outing is organized under the responsibility of an outing leader, who acts in a voluntary, unpaid capacity. He/she has the right to cancel the excursion, change its date, modify its itinerary (as long as the level of difficulty remains unchanged), and exclude persons from participating who are ill-equipped or in inadequate physical shape.
Sign-up: at the “permanence” in the
restaurant of the Sporting Club of Varembé (Centre Sportif de Varembé), 46,
avenue Giuseppe-Motta, on Thursdays between 6 p.m. and 7:30 p.m. The leader of
the outing can limit the number of participants (in such instances, Club members
have preference over non-members). At the start of the excursion, moreover, the
leader may refuse to accept a person who is not already signed-up.
Sign-up charge: 5 CHF per outing day for
members of the Club; 15 CHF for non-members.
Cost: The cost for each excursion is
approximate. It includes the daily charge, transportation and, when applicable,
accommodations and some meals. The exact cost will be provided at the
“permanence” at sign-up time. Payment may be asked of participants at the
sign-up time, except for certain travel costs (see below). In cases where
payments have been made in advance and an excursion is cancelled, the persons
concerned will be reimbursed in full. If the outing takes place, signed-up
persons who do not show up will be reimbursed fully except for the daily charge
and any cancellation costs falling upon the leader of the outing. The surcharge
of 10 CHF for non-members will be fully reimbursed. Transportation: By public transport or private vehicles. In cases of travel by car, drivers are compensated on the basis of 0.15 CHF per km/passenger. The outing head indicates during sign-up the amount to be paid per passenger. Each passenger settles this sum directly with his/her driver at the time of departure on the outing. In cases of travel by public transport, the excursion leader may request participants to purchase their tickets themselves, or may purchase a group ticket, in which case the amount of the ticket may be included in the amount to be paid by participants at the time of signing-up.

kit. Rules to comply with in order to participate in an outing
In the case of drivers, be covered by
civil responsibility insurance, in particular with respect to fellow
passengers. Accident and rescue insurance: It is the personal responsibility of each participant to carry insurance against accidents and mountain rescue, in particular helicopter rescue operations.
Check with your employer to see if you
are properly insured.
La Rega (Garde Aérienne Suisse de
Sauvetage) provides coverage for helicopter rescue and repatriation
(30 CHF annually. Tel. 0844 834 844). There are other similar
personal insurance schemes, in particular Air-Glaciers (Tel. +41 27
329 1415.)
